Как правильно отобразить список ошибок под моим компонентом? - PullRequest
0 голосов
/ 27 марта 2020

Я использую React 16.13.0 и Bootstrap 4. Я хочу отобразить список ошибок поля, когда в моем компоненте заполнена правильная переменная. У меня есть это

  {props.errors && props.errors[props.name] && (
      <FormControl.Feedback>
             {props.errors[props.name].map((error, index) => ( 
                 <div key={field-error-${props.name}-${index}} className="fieldError">{error}</div>
             )}  
      </FormControl.Feedback>
  )}

Однако это не скомпилируется

  Line 20:45:  Parsing error: Unexpected token, expected "}"

  18 |           <FormControl.Feedback>
  19 |                  {props.errors[props.name].map((error, index) => (
> 20 |                      <div key={field-error-${props.name}-${index}} className="fieldError">{error}</div>
     |                                             ^
  21 |                  )} 
  22 |           </FormControl.Feedback>
  23 |       )}

Я не уверен, что я делаю неправильно - есть ли другой способ ссылаться на мой props.name var

1 Ответ

0 голосов
/ 27 марта 2020

Я думаю, что вам не хватает кавычек:

key={`field-error-${props.name}-${index}`}
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...